===Part 2=== The town at dusk. Hal and Flamberge were walking on a street in the shopping district, led by Mabel. The street was full of people shopping, people going home from work and shopkeepers at their market stalls. But mysteriously, this scene didn't give off a lively impression. Certainly, one could hear the yells of the workers, who were lifting heavy luggage, or the fancy marketing phrases of the shop assistants. The shopkeepers were talking happily to their customers and the laughs of a bunch of playing kids resounded in the street. There were even people chatting together at the side of the street while drinking some liquor. And yet, all of this seemed somehow feigned. It was almost like watching the actors of a bad play. Next to Hal, who was gazing grimly at those people, the constrained girl Flam scoffed. "Now should I call this town lively or gloo<span style="font-variant: small-caps;">my</span>?" "Don't forget that we're in the countryside here. Everybody is earnest," Mabel said, defending the people of this town. After sneaking a peek at her, Hal looked around at the buildings. Then he murmured, "An earnest rural town, huh...? There are quite many brothels, though." "Isn't that your <span style="font-variant: small-caps;">type</span>?" Flam said, chuckling and pointing at a nearby building. Below a gaudy signboard, which made the type of the shop clear at one glance, there was a young woman appealing to men while exposing her skin generously. The shop was enveloped by a dissolute mood which didn't suit such a little remote town at all. "Well... that's because there was a weapon factory, you see..." Mabel stammered an excuse. "A weapon factory?" Hal asked after turning around calmly. "During the war it was lively there, with military people and migrant workers. And the same can be said for this place here... well, and thus the prostitutes gathered, aiming for that," Mabel said with a regrettable tone and shrugged. "To tell you the truth, that's also why I was employed as a police officer. Police men can have quite a hard time dealing with trouble about brothels." "I see," Hal nodded seriously. The constrained girl looked up to him and raised a sardonic chuckle. "A town with lots of brothels, huh... you must be happy that we came here after hearing those <span style="font-variant: small-caps;">rumors</span>! Aren't ya, Hal?" "Don't try to misrepresent the facts," Hal replied with a scowl. "What rumors?" asked Mabel, cocking her head. After letting out a short sigh, Hal said: "Apparently there are many people who go missing in this town, huh?" "Eh?" Mabel blinked in surprise. He didn't mind her and continued. "I heard that more than 80 people disappeared during the two years after the end of the war. That's quite an extraordinary number, considering the population of this town." "80 people...?" Mabel grumbled in amazement and turned pale. She strained to form a smile, but she only managed to make her lips quiver. "You heard a lie... that can't possibly be." "What makes you so sure?" he asked back in a voice devoid of emotion. "Don't forget that I'm a police officer! I would definitely know it if something like that really happened in this town. In the recent years, not a single person went missing or died. At the most, you could say that some of the elderly who had been ill for a long time deceased in a hospital far away in another town---" Mabel clearly tried hard to explain. But Hal went straight to the point. "Almost all of the people who went missing aren't from here. They were travelers, merchants and other passers-by." "You make it sound as if the inhabitants of this town would attack any stranger who passes by, don't you?" Mabel frowned, offended. Then she continued with an angry voice, "In that case, the next target would be the two of you." "I hope so at least," he nodded with a serious mien. Mabel gazed at him in disbelief, but she could not find a single sign of a joke. She sighed, getting a grip on herself again, and looked seriously at him. "Perhaps, the people you're searching for... also went missing in this town?" "Who knows?" murmured the strangely-clothed man, while clasping his staff harder, which made the metallic rod creak lightly in his hand. "You don't know?" "That's why we came here. To investigate if it has something to do with them." "I see," Mabel nodded slightly. Then she stopped in front of a house. Despite being old, it could be called a well-built 3-story house. Stone stairs led to the entrance, which was decorated with simple but pretty carvings. "We're here!" Mabel walked up the stairs with sure steps and showed them in, pointing at the door. The house was apparently her home. "Such a house despite living <span style="font-variant: small-caps;">alone</span>? Quite uptown, aren't ya? Does it pay to be a corrupted police offi<span style="font-variant: small-caps;">cer</span>?" Flam asked, impressed. "I ain't corrupted!" Mabel pursed her lips. "And I'm not living on my own either." With a slightly proud face, she opened the door. Her home wasn't as luxurious as it looked from outside, but still it was spacious. Right in front of the entry hall was a stairway, leading to the second floor, and on the right hand side was the living room in which a stove was burning. A woolen sofa was placed in front of that stove and on it, was an old couple. They noticed Mabel's arrival and turned slowly around. "Welcome home, Mabel." "You must be tired, Mabel." They spoke stiffly, which resembled the sound of rusty gears, and smiled. That smile, however, seemed as artificial as the smile of a mechanical puppet. But Mabel ignored their unnatural behavior and smiled back at them. "Hello everybody. I've brought some guests with me. Two travelers called... err, Hal and Flam." The two old persons turned around to Hal. With the exact same expression. Then they smiled again artificially. "I see. Welcome." "I see. You must be very tired from the journey." They seemed as if they were repeating a set of decided phrases. Hal didn't pay attention to them and turned around to Mabel instead. "Who are they?" "They are my grandparents. Then there is..." Mabel looked at the stairway. From its landing, one could hear the footsteps of someone coming downstairs. The steps had a light sound to them, implying a rather low body weight. Eventually, a little head appeared over the handrail. It was a little girl, around 12 or 13 years old. Her face looked almost like a younger version of Mabel's. "Who are you?" Her hazelnut brown eyes darted between Hal and Flam, giving them a reproving look. "Patty." Mabel called the name of the girl, letting her know that she was behaving impolitely. Then she turned an awkward smile to her guests. "She's my little sister Patricia. Patty, these people are Hal and Flam. I decided to let them spend the night here---" "What did you come here for?" Patricia shouted snappily, ignoring the friendly introduction of her elder sister. "Leave! Just get out already!" She then dashed up the stairs without leaving them time to even respond to her. After a few moments, one could hear a door closing upstairs. Patricia had shut herself in her room. "Patty! Wait a moment... Patty!" Mabel ran away, following her little sister. After gazing at the disappearing woman, Flam sighed with a frown. "That girl sure behaved <span style="font-variant: small-caps;">poorly</span>. Maybe she noticed that you're a perv who's dead keen on little <span style="font-variant: small-caps;">girls</span>, right, Hal?" "I'm neither a pervert nor keen on little girls. I do, however, think that this might be interesting---" Hal answered Flam, contrary to custom, seriously. "Mh?" The confined girl looked up at Hal, raising her slender chin. Her light, silver eyes became narrow like a cat's. "At least that girl seems to have enough emotions to dislike me," murmured Hal, almost keeping a straight face. Bathing in the light of the stove, lights flickered on the silver staff - like flames.
